    Job Overview:

    Production Floor Supervisor 

     

    Front-line people leader responsible for multiple cells/lines within a shift. Ensures a safe workplace, product quality, on-time delivery, and efficient use of labor and equipment. Coaches team leads and technicians, manages daily tier accountability, and coordinates with cross-functional partners. May be assigned to a specific Premier PV product line (e.g., PV eBOS equipment, PV harness & electrical assemblies, or structural/mechanical components).

    Key Responsibilities: 

    • Own daily safety, quality, delivery, and cost results for assigned area; lead tier-1/2 meetings and Gemba walks. 

    • Plan labor, assign work, approve time, and manage attendance/performance within company policies. 

    • Ensure adherence to SOPs, standard work, and regulatory/industry standards as applicable. 

    • Drive throughput and OEE; manage changeovers, downtime responses, and escalation to Maintenance/Engineering. 

    • Partner with Planning, Warehouse, and Quality to maintain material availability and resolve nonconformances. 

    • Develop team capabilities through coaching, feedback, and skills certification; maintain training matrices. 

    • Lead root-cause investigations and implement corrective/preventive actions; track results. 

    • Sustain 5S, visual controls, and audit readiness; support internal/external audits.
